Anti-tank regiments had four batteries of twelve guns each. The Batterie consisted of three troops with four guns in two sections. Anti-tank regiments of infantry divisions were equipped with 6 pdr anti-tank guns, to be replaced by the more powerful 17 pdr anti-tank guns as they became available. In addition to the divisional anti-tank assets, each infantry battalion had an anti-tank platoon with three sections of two 6 pdr anti-tank guns. The 6 pdr anti-tank gun was served by two Lloyd Carriers. Vehicles carried numbered und colour-coded Tac Signs on the right fender. The two-coloured tac signs shown below were actually arranged with the first colour above the second colour, not adjacent to eachother. Britische Infanterie Division 1944
Vehicles carried the Battalion Tac Sign on the right front und rear fender, und the divisional symbol on the left fender.
